The size of Parkville is approximately 4.1 square kilometres. There are 23 parks, covering nearly 51.1% of the total area. The population of Parkville in 2016 was 7409 people. By 2021 the population was 7074 showing a population decline of 4.5%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Parkville is 20-29 years. Households in Parkville are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Parkville work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 32.50% of the homes in Parkville were owner-occupied compared with 31.60% in 2016.
